Understanding Proton Therapy

Proton therapy utilizes high-energy protons to target cancer cells in the lungs. Unlike traditional radiation therapy, which uses X-rays, proton therapy focuses on using protons that can be precisely controlled. This precision allows doctors to deliver the optimal dose of radiation directly to the tumor while sparing surrounding healthy tissues.

Benefits of Proton Therapy

One of the primary benefits of proton therapy for lung cancer is its ability to minimize damage to nearby organs and healthy tissues. This targeted approach can be particularly beneficial for patients with lung cancer, as it allows for higher doses with fewer side effects. Research has indicated that this could lead to better outcomes, including improved quality of life post-treatment.

Additionally, proton therapy often results in fewer long-term side effects compared to conventional therapies. Considerations in Proton Therapy

While there are distinct advantages to proton therapy, there are also important considerations to keep in mind. For instance, not all patients are eligible for proton therapy. This technique may be more suitable for specific types of lung cancer or stages of the disease. Individual health considerations, tumor size, and location play crucial roles in determining the appropriate treatment.

Within the realm of proton therapy for lung cancer, several open questions remain a topic of discussion among experts. First, there is ongoing research into the long-term outcomes of proton therapy compared to traditional treatments. Secondly, scientists are still assessing the cost-effectiveness of proton therapy, especially regarding access for various socioeconomic groups. Lastly, experts debate whether proton therapy could be beneficial for more advanced stages of lung cancer. As these discussions continue, updated findings will help shape future treatment strategies for lung cancer patients.
